Q: Is 42,260,008 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 42,260,008 is a composite number.

Why is 42,260,008 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 42,260,008 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 28 56 313 626 1,252 2,191 2,411 2,504 4,382 4,822 8,764 9,644 16,877 17,528 19,288 33,754 67,508 135,016 754,643 1,509,286 3,018,572 5,282,501 6,037,144 10,565,002 21,130,004 and 42,260,008, with no remainder.

Since 42,260,008 cannot be divided by just 1 and 42,260,008, it is a composite number.
